1) Conducting keyword research is crucial to identify the most relevant and popular keywords for your website.

These keywords should be included in your title tags, meta descriptions, and throughout your content to improve your ranking on Google. You may also consider using them if you run Google Ad campaigns, or to conduct competitor and market research. For even more on this, see this guide on keyword research including identifying keyword intent.

2) Optimizing your website's title tags and meta descriptions is essential for attracting users to your site.

These elements should accurately and compellingly describe your content and include the targeted keywords to improve your ranking on Google. It is important to note that Google programmatically pulls in the title and description based on a user's search, so it is crucial to optimize these elements to ensure that your website appears prominently in the search results. By taking the time to carefully craft your title tags and meta descriptions, you can improve your website's visibility and attract more users to your site.

3) Incorporating targeted keywords into your content is crucial for improving your ranking on Google.

Use these keywords in your headings, subheadings, and body text to signal to search engines the relevance of your content to users' search queries. It is important to be mindful of the keyword density, or the number of times a keyword appears in relation to the total number of words on the page, when incorporating keywords into your content. Keyword stuffing, or the practice of excessively using keywords in an attempt to manipulate search rankings, is not only ineffective, but it can also harm your website's ranking and user experience. Instead, aim to create helpful, informative, and easy-to-read content that naturally incorporates your targeted keywords. By focusing on creating high-quality content that provides value to users, you can improve your ranking on Google and attract more visitors to your website.

4) High-quality, unique, and engaging content is essential for attracting and retaining users on your website.

It is important to provide value to users and address their needs and interests through your content to keep them engaged and interested in your site. Good content can also help to improve your ranking on Google. Search engines want to provide the best possible results to users, so they will rank websites with high-quality, relevant content higher in the search results. By consistently producing unique and valuable content, you can establish your website as an authority in your industry and improve your ranking on Google. Additionally, good content can help to attract links and social shares, which can also contribute to your ranking on the search engine. Overall, investing in high-quality, unique, and engaging content is a crucial element of a successful SEO strategy.

5) Internal linking helps to improve the navigation and flow of your website, making it easier for users and search engines to find and access your content.

By linking related pages on your site, you can improve your ranking on Google. This is because you build "link juice" internally, and point users to even more helpful content that they may be interested in that is relevant.

6) External linking is a way to establish credibility and authority for your website.

By linking to reputable sources, you can show search engines the value of your content and improve your ranking on Google. Not just that, but in SEO, "followed" links are considered more valuable because they are the default behavior for links. "No-followed" links were introduced to combat spam, but they can cause problems if used too frequently. To encourage websites to link to other sites, Google rewards websites that use followed links. Pro tip: It is important to carefully manage your use of external links by creating a whitelist or blacklist of trusted or untrusted domains, rather than no-following every external link.

7) Optimizing images and videos is important for improving the user experience on your website and for ranking on Google.

Use descriptive and keyword-rich file names and alt text for your media to signal to search engines the relevance of these elements to your content. Alternative (alt) text is also important for user experience overall, and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) mandate using it to help folks who may have temporary or permanent disAbilities.

10) Long-tail keywords are more specific and less competitive than short-tail keywords, making them a useful tool for targeting a specific audience.

These keywords are often more descriptive and contain more than one or two words, making them more closely aligned with the way users typically search for information. By incorporating long-tail keywords into your content, you can increase the chances of ranking for those keywords and improve your overall ranking on Google. By targeting a specific audience with long-tail keywords, you can also attract more qualified traffic to your website and potentially generate more leads or sales. It is important to note that while long-tail keywords may have lower search volume, they can still drive valuable traffic to your website and should be a key part of your overall SEO strategy.

11) Optimizing your website's loading speed and user experience is essential for improving its performance and ranking on Google.

A slow-loading website can be frustrating for users and may lead them to leave your site before they have a chance to engage with your content. According to Google research, "a one-second delay in mobile load times can impact conversion rates by up to 20%." On the other hand, a fast-loading website with a seamless user experience can keep users on your site longer and encourage them to explore more of your content. This can ultimately improve your ranking on Google, as search engines consider loading speed and user experience as ranking factors. There are several ways to optimize your website's loading speed and user experience, including optimizing images, minifying CSS and JavaScript, using a content delivery network (CDN), and reducing the number of redirects and external requests. By taking the time to optimize these elements, you can improve your website's performance and ranking on Google.

12) Local keywords and optimization for local search can be particularly effective for improving your ranking on Google for users in a specific location.

By incorporating local keywords and optimizing your website for local search, you can improve your visibility and ranking in the search results. For example, a Pennsylvania-based marketing firm may want to include the regions served, such as "Pennsylvania SEO Agency" on the homepage of your site.

13) Claiming and optimizing your Google My Business listing is a great way to improve your visibility and ranking in local search results.

By providing accurate and relevant information about your business, you can improve your ranking on Google. You can see how many views your listing gets, and even post updates and respond to positive or negative reviews for reputation management.

14) Schema markup is a way to provide additional information and context to search engines about your content.

It is a type of code that is added to the HTML of your website and helps search engines understand the meaning and structure of your content. By using schema markup, you can help search engines understand the content on your website and improve your ranking on Google. There are several types of schema markup, including product, event, recipe, and article schema. By using the appropriate schema markup for your content, you can help search engines understand the relevance and context of your content to users' search queries. This can improve the chances of your website appearing in rich results, such as rich snippets or featured snippets, which can increase its visibility and improve its ranking on Google. In addition to improving your ranking, schema markup can also help to increase the click-through rate (CTR) of your website by providing users with more information about your content in the search results.

15) Creating and submitting a sitemap is a way to help search engines crawl and index your website more efficiently.

A sitemap is a file that lists all the pages, posts, and other content on your website, along with their respective URLs. By providing a comprehensive and up-to-date sitemap, you can improve your ranking on Google. When search engines crawl your website, they use the sitemap as a roadmap to discover and index your content. This can help ensure that all of your pages and posts are being properly indexed and considered for ranking. It is important to note that sitemaps are not a ranking factor in and of themselves, but they can help search engines discover and index your content more efficiently, which can ultimately improve your ranking. In addition to creating a sitemap, you should also regularly update it to reflect any changes or additions to your website. This will help ensure that search engines have the most current and accurate information about your website.

16) Technical errors or issues, such as broken links or crawl errors, can negatively affect your ranking on Google.

These types of issues can create a poor user experience and make it more difficult for search engines to crawl and index your website, which can ultimately harm your ranking. By regularly monitoring and addressing any such issues, you can improve your ranking on the search engine. There are several tools and resources available to help you monitor and address technical errors and issues on your website, including Google Search Console and SEO audit tools. By using these tools to identify and fix issues, you can ensure that your website is running smoothly and performing optimally. In addition to monitoring and addressing technical errors and issues, it is also important to regularly update and maintain your website to prevent such issues from occurring in the first place. By taking proactive measures to maintain your website, you can improve your ranking on Google and provide a better user experience for your visitors.

17) Google Search Console is a useful tool for tracking and analyzing your website's performance on Google.

19) To improve your ranking on Google, it is often best to use a combination of on-page and off-page SEO strategies.

On-page strategies involve optimizing the content and structure of your own website, such as using targeted keywords in your content and optimizing your website's loading speed. Off-page strategies involve building links and citations from external websites, such as by promoting your content on social media or getting mentioned in news articles. By using a combination of both types of strategies, you can improve your overall ranking on Google. On-page and off-page SEO strategies work together to help search engines understand the relevance and value of your website to users. By optimizing both the content and structure of your website and building links and citations from external sources, you can demonstrate to search engines that your website is a valuable and useful resource for users. This can help improve your ranking on Google and increase the visibility and traffic to your website.

Pillar content, also known as cornerstone content, is an important part of any website's content strategy. It is a long-form, in-depth piece of content that covers a broad topic in great detail and serves as the foundation for a website's content strategy. The purpose of pillar content is to establish the website as a reliable and authoritative source of information on that topic, and to provide a structure for organizing and linking to other related content on the website.

How long is pillar content supposed to be?

Pillar content is typically between 1,500 and 2,500 words in length and is designed to provide a comprehensive overview of a particular topic. It is often used to attract and retain visitors to a website, as well as to improve the website's 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s).

Benefits of using pillar content

One of the key benefits of pillar content is that it provides a foundation for a website's content strategy. By creating a long-form, in-depth piece of content on a particular topic, a website can establish itself as a go-to source of information on that topic. This can be especially useful for websites that cover a specific niche or industry, as it allows them to differentiate themselves from other websites and establish themselves as experts in their field.

Pillar content can also help to improve a website's visibility in search engine results. By creating high-quality, comprehensive and helpful content on a particular topic, a website can attract a larger number of visitors who are searching for information on that topic. This can lead to increased traffic and potentially higher search engine rankings, as search engines tend to favor websites that offer valuable, relevant content to their users.

How to create pillar content

Creating effective pillar content is not always easy. Here are some tips for creating helpful pillar content for your website:

  1. Choose a relevant and interesting topic: The first step in creating pillar content is to choose a topic that is relevant and interesting to your target audience. It's important to choose a topic that is closely related to your website's focus and that will be of value to your readers.
  2. Research the topic thoroughly: Once you have chosen a topic, it's important to do thorough research to ensure that your content is accurate and well-informed. Gather as much information as you can from a variety of sources, including industry experts, academic journals, and online resources.
  3. Organize the content into a clear structure: One of the keys to creating effective pillar content is to organize the content into a clear and logical structure. Use headings and subheadings to break up the content into manageable sections, and use examples and images to illustrate your points and make the content more engaging.
  4. Edit and proofread carefully: It's important to take the time to edit and proofread your pillar content carefully to ensure that it is accurate, well-written, and easy to understand. Pay particular attention to grammar, spelling, and punctuation, and consider having someone else review the content for feedback and suggestions.
  5. Use relevant keywords: Another important aspect of creating helpful pillar content is to use relevant keywords throughout the content. This will help search engines understand what the content is about and improve its ranking in search results. However, it's important to use keywords naturally and in a way that makes sense for the content.

By following these tips, you can create high-quality, comprehensive pillar content that will be useful and valuable to your audience, and that will help to improve your website's visibility and credibility.

Are you a nonprofit communication professional looking for the best possible content management system (CMS) to manage your organization's website? Look no further than WordPress. Whether you are looking to create a new nonprofit website or redesign your existing one, WordPress for nonprofits is a no-brainer.

Here are five reasons why the WordPress CMS is the go-to solution for nonprofit websites:

1) User-Friendly and Easy to Learn

WordPress is designed with simplicity in mind, making it easy for anyone to learn and use. Nonprofits often have limited resources and staff, so a user-friendly CMS is crucial. With WordPress, you don't need any special technical skills or coding knowledge to create a professional website.

2) Customizable and Flexible

WordPress offers endless customization options, allowing you to design and tailor your website to fit the needs and goals of your organization. You can choose from a wide range of themes and plugins to add features and functionality to your site. Whether you need an event calendar, donation form, or social media integration, there's a WordPress plugin for that.

3) SEO-Friendly and Mobile-First

Search engine optimization (SEO) is important for any website, but especially for nonprofits that rely on donations and support from the community. WordPress is SEO-friendly, meaning it's easier for search engines like Google to crawl and index your site. Additionally, WordPress automatically optimizes your site for mobile devices, ensuring it looks great and functions properly on all screens.

4) Secure and Reliable

Security is a top concern for any website, and WordPress takes it seriously. They regularly release updates to fix vulnerabilities and improve security measures. Plus, there are many security plugins available to add an extra layer of protection to your site. With WordPress, you can trust that your site is secure and reliable.

5) Cost-Effective

One of the biggest benefits of WordPress is that it's free to use. You'll only need to pay for hosting, a domain name, and any premium themes or plugins you choose to use. This makes it an affordable option for nonprofits that may have limited budgets.

WordPress is the perfect CMS for nonprofit websites.

It's user-friendly, customizable, SEO-friendly, secure, and cost-effective. Search engine optimization is essential for ensuring your web app is found by potential users. Web app SEO is a complex subject, but we've boiled it down to just 7 steps to help you improve the SEO of a dynamic web application:

  1. Use clean, descriptive URLs that include keywords relevant to the page's content. This will make the page more easily indexed by search engines and make it more likely to rank well for relevant keywords.
  2. Use correct HTML tags, such as header tags and meta tags, to clearly define the content and structure of the page. This will help search engines understand the content and organization of the page, which can improve its ranking.
  3. Create a sitemap that lists all of the pages on the site, including any dynamic content, to help search engines index the site more effectively. A sitemap can also make it easier for users to navigate the site, which can improve their experience and increase the likelihood of them returning to the site. This can be an XML sitemap, along with an HTML sitemap, for example.
  4. Use keyword-rich, descriptive page titles and meta descriptions to give search engines an idea of what the page is about and to convey value (helpful content). This may, in turn, encourage users to click on the result. This can help the page rank higher in search results and increase the chances of users clicking on the result and visiting the site.
  5. Regularly update the content on the site to keep it fresh and relevant, and to give search engines a reason to continue to crawl and index the site. Updating the content can also improve the user experience and help the site maintain its ranking in search results.
  6. Use social media and other online channels to promote the site and to generate links from other websites, which can improve the site's search engine ranking. Promoting the site on social media and other online channels can also help increase its visibility and attract more visitors.
  7. Monitor and analyze the site's performance using tools like Google Analytics to identify areas for improvement and to track the effectiveness of any changes made to the site. Monitoring and analyzing the site's performance can help identify problems and opportunities and allow for data-driven decision making.
